I think I have found the issue !!!!!!!
Its the PCIe Express NVMe Card.
I remove it and the desktop seems not to hang .... I add it back in .... and the desktop hangs.
I wonder if this has something to do with power spikes when there is graphics activity the errors in the dmesg indicate that
vpcie1v8 = 5.1v rail Shared with GPU
vpcie0v9 = 3v Rail
Both of these rails hang off the same core buck converter SY8113B, the other SY8113B manages the USB peripherals seperatly.
@AndrewDB .... looks like you may be correct it was power all along but it looks like its a kernel issue with the PCIe Power Management ?

@NicoD @johanvdw Actually with some of the out of tree patches is possible to make it work. After all, I have fully functional LibreELEC image for PineH64. Well, not completely everything, but HDMI audio works pretty well. Patches are here and here. Btw, dma patches are important for audio and you have to enable sun4i-i2s driver and simple audio card if it's not yet.

OK, OPi3 shows dcdca going to 1160000. The datasheet on the AXP805 has a weird 2-stage step size, but more concerning to me is the fact it seems to suggest there are 72 steps in a 6-bit number...
I'll make it match Opi-3 and not mess with the opp other than to correct it's syntax to match the rest of the opps
@NicoD even sitting at 1.488 forever running youtube video it isn't even warming up with a Tinker factory heatsink on it. I think we're probably in good shape heat wise, surprisingly.
